47.93Apply it to “Happy Birthday”

This may be more useful than putting it into yet another odd meter.

Keep:

4/4 throughout.

Phrase 1

ordinary placement.

The listener learns the melody.

Phrase 2

same melody with 3+3+2 accompaniment.

Phrase 3

climactic melody fragments displaced by one eighth and allowed to cross barlines.

Phrase 4

begin rhythmically ambiguous.

Then final melody note and tonic arrive strongly on beat 1.

The transformation comes not from changing meter but from destabilizing and restoring the listener's relationship to the meter.
